Ruth T.
Melitz
Aug 19, 1925 — Feb 23, 2008
Kaukauna – Ruth T. Melitz, formerly of Racine, passed away in the St. Paul Elder Nursing home on Saturday, February 23, 2008 She was 82. She was born in Racine on August 19, 1925, daughter of the late Henry and Mary (nee: Piotrowski) Henneke. On November 11, 1950 she was united in holy matrimony to Bruno Melitz. While Ruth was born in Racine, she grew up with her family in Germany and returned to States after the war, finding her way to Milwaukee where she met and later married Bruno. They moved to Racine shortly thereafter and Ruth spent the next 25 years raising 6 children, keeping a spotless house and cooking the most delicious German meals. What little free time she could find was spent playing cards. When her beloved Bruno died in 1976, Ruth finished raising the rest of her family then sought out new endeavors including bowling and traveling while adding bridge to her card playing repertoire. Other than the occasional baseball game on television, nights were spent enjoying a book or working crossword puzzles. Whenever the kids came to visit there was always plenty of food on the table which was quickly replaced by cards, scrabble, yahtzee or whatever was the game of the day. Her passing leaves an empty seat at the family card table.
